About CIDR Notation
CIDR (Classless Inter-Domain Routing) is a method for allocating IP addresses and routing. The CIDR notation combines an IP address with its network prefix length.
For example, 192.168.1.0/24 indicates an IPv4 address where the first 24 bits are the network portion, leaving 8 bits for host addresses (256 total, 254 usable).
Common IPv4 Subnet Sizes
| CIDR | Subnet Mask | Total IPs | Usable IPs |
|---|---|---|---|
| /24 | 255.255.255.0 | 256 | 254 |
| /25 | 255.255.255.128 | 128 | 126 |
| /26 | 255.255.255.192 | 64 | 62 |
| /27 | 255.255.255.224 | 32 | 30 |
| /28 | 255.255.255.240 | 16 | 14 |
| /29 | 255.255.255.248 | 8 | 6 |
| /30 | 255.255.255.252 | 4 | 2 |
